Windows批量修改文件名 - bat

本文介绍了批处理文件的基本概念,它是DOS环境下的一种文本文件,包含一系列命令,可通过CMD执行。文章详细讲解了如何使用ren命令进行文件改名,dir命令获取文件列表,以及for循环命令的应用,展示如何结合这些命令实现批量操作。

bat文件是dos下的批处理文件。批处理文件是无格式的文本文件,它包含一条或多条命令。它的文件扩展名为 .bat 或 .cmd。在命令提示下输入批处理文件的名称,或者双击该批处理文件,系统就会调用cmd.exe按照该文件中各个命令出现的顺序来逐个运行它们。

常用命令

1. ren: 改名
ren a.txt b.txt

将a.txt改为b.txt

2. dir 批量得到文件名的命令
dir /b *.doc > list.txt

dir为directory的缩写,意为:目录,这里表示,显示目录中的文件和子目录列表;

/b表示,不显示修改日期等信息,只显示文件名;

list:是输出结果的文件名,可以随便命名;

后缀名:xls,txt,doc等都可以,分别表示输出的文件类型为:Excel、文本文档、Word等;

3. for循环命令
for %%i in (1 2 3 4 5) do echo %%i

循环显示1 2 3 4 5

那么它们组合在一起

for /f %%i in ('dir /b *.doc') do (ren %%i 改名%%i改名)

就可以实现批量改名了

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值